Kiwisaver first home deposit subsidy

Central Conveyancing can assist you with your application for a first home deposit subsidy.

If you're eligible and the property you're buying meets the deposit subsidy criteria, a Kiwisaver first home deposit subsidy can provide you with a funding boost towards home ownership. 

After 3 years of contributing to KiwiSaver, you may be entitled to a first home deposit subsidy. The subsidy is administered by Housing New Zealand. This subsidy will be paid to your conveyancer on the day the purchase of the property is settled.

The first home deposit subsidy is $1,000 for each year you've been contributing to KiwiSaver, up to a maximum of $5,000 for five years.  If you're a couple buying a house together and you both qualify for a subsidy, you could receive a combined subsidy of up to $10,000.

Kiwisaver scheme first home withdrawal

Central Conveyancing can assist you with your application for a first home withdrawal of your Kiwisaver Scheme savings.  If you池e a member of a complying fund and want to use your savings for your first home withdrawal you'll need to check with your provider to see if they offer this.

You may be able to withdraw some or all of your KiwiSaver savings (except for the $1,000 kick-start and member tax credit) to put towards buying your first home.  You must have been a KiwiSaver member for three or more years and you can only withdraw money to buy your first home - not an investment property. You'll need to apply to your KiwiSaver provider if you want to make a first home withdrawal.

Subdivision

Central Conveyancing can assist you with your subdivision project. 

Whether you are a property investor or developer planning a large-scale subdivision or a property owner seeking a boundary adjustment or anything in bewteen - the team at Central COnveyancing would be delighted to assist.

We are experienced in a wide range of subdivision activities from completing boundary adjustments, fee simple, cross lease and unit title subdivisions to the amalgamation of titles and associated legal work such as creation of easements and registration of covenants.  Central Conveyancing will work with your surveyor and planning professionals to ensure that your subdivision is completed in a timely and cost efficient manner.

WILLS

A Will is a written document that you make setting out how you wish your estate to be disposed of after your death.  Your Will sets out your wishes for providing for your loved ones and details how your affairs are to be managed after you are gone. 

You can specify:
・who you'd like to provide for, including any gifts
・guardians for children under 18
・plans for your funeral
・an executor and trustee to carry out your wishes

If a person dies without a Will (called 訴ntestate・, the Administration Act 1969 provides a list of beneficiaries in order, starting with the spouse, children, parents, brothers and sisters, uncles and aunts. 

So, while no one likes to think about the inevitability of their own death, every adult should have an up-to-date Will - it's one of the most valuable legal documents you'll have.  A Will can help ensure the people and things that matter to you most are taken care of after you're gone.
